A dramatic call to hurry: By January 19, 2025, everyone who was born in 1971 or later must exchange their old paper driving license for a new one! But the reality looks dark: in many circles, including Plön, Pinneberg and Stormarn, only about 11,000 out of 25,000 expected exchange campaigns took place. Time is running, and if you are still caught with the old driver's license, you risk a fine of 10 euros - a joke compared to the exchanging costs of around 30 euros! But be careful: this can lead to serious problems abroad or rental cars!
important deadlines and steps
The countdown is running! Anyone who was born before 1953 can keep their document by 2033. For everyone else it means: act now! The first step to the new driver's license is the requirement of a index card, especially if the old driver's license was issued in a different circle. In most cases, this is quick and free of charge by email. But be careful: Neumünster states that the processing can take up to six weeks!
The next step? A biometric passport photo! Only a few authorities have had machines on site, ideally photographed themselves and have them developed in drugstores. But the picture has to be sharp and without shadow - otherwise there are problems! Applications must be submitted personally or by post, with some circles also offering online processing. The waiting times are increasing the closer the deadline. The federal printing company needs between two and six weeks to issue the new driver's license, and in the high phase it could even be up to three months!
In some circles, the old driver's license can even be kept, while others insist that it is devalued or moved in. So if you haven't exchanged, you should hurry and take the necessary steps to avoid nasty surprises!
